How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Colbert?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Colbert Studio Apartments | $1,444 | $1,357 | $1,715 |
Colbert 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,472 | $650 | $2,117 |
Colbert 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,659 | $525 | $4,105 |
Colbert 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,764 | $809 | $4,425 |
Colbert 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,206 | $729 | $3,020 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
